Étapes Pour Résoudre Positivement L’erreur SQL Ora-00979 Sans Groupes D’expressions Célèbres

November 6, 2021 By Mohammed Butcher Off

 

Si vous n’avez pas vu l’erreur SQL ora-00979, groupée par expression, ce guide de faits clés devrait vous aider.

Recommandé : Fortect

  • 1. Téléchargez et installez Fortect
  • 2. Ouvrez le programme et cliquez sur "Scan"
  • 3. Cliquez sur "Réparer" pour lancer le processus de réparation
  • Téléchargez ce logiciel et réparez votre PC en quelques minutes.

    g.ORA-00979 “Not some GROUP BY expression” doit être une erreur renvoyée par une collection Oracle lorsqu’une instruction SELECT a produit une colonne primaire qui n’est pas nécessairement répertoriée comme la dernière GROUP BY et n’est pas agrégée. Ce message d’erreur peut être déroutant pour les apprenants. Pratiquez vos bases de SQL avec une variété définie d’exercices dans notre cours Web SQL Practice Set !

     

     

    g.

    ORA-00979

    ORA-00979 devrait utiliser la clause GROUP BY. Lorsque le compte idéal rencontre cette erreur, il consultera le message « Continuer avec » :

    ORA-00979 : mots désagréables GROUP BY

    Par rapport aux autres inconvénients d’Oracle, ORA-00979 est généralement simple et peut être facilement résolu en utilisant l’une des trois méthodes.

    Mère à problèmes

    Recommandé : Fortect

    Vous en avez assez que votre ordinateur fonctionne lentement ? Est-il truffé de virus et de logiciels malveillants ? N'ayez crainte, mon ami, car Fortect est là pour sauver la mise ! Cet outil puissant est conçu pour diagnostiquer et réparer toutes sortes de problèmes Windows, tout en améliorant les performances, en optimisant la mémoire et en maintenant votre PC comme neuf. Alors n'attendez plus - téléchargez Fortect dès aujourd'hui !

  • 1. Téléchargez et installez Fortect
  • 2. Ouvrez le programme et cliquez sur "Scan"
  • 3. Cliquez sur "Réparer" pour lancer le processus de réparation

  • ORA-00979 se produit lorsque chacune de nos clauses GROUP BY ne comprend pas toutes les expressions dans le cadre de notre propre clause SELECT. Tout concept SELECT qui n’est probablement pas présent dans notre propre accomplissement GROUP doit être re-spécifié dans la clause GROUP BY. Ceux-ci peuvent être AVG, COUNT, MAX, SUM, min, STDDEV, et donc VARIANCE. Vous avez peut-être également acheté une instruction SELECT contenant une clause GROUP BY.

    Solution

    Pour corriger cette erreur, ré-incluez certaines instructions SELECT dans la clause GROUP BY. Assurez-vous que les expressions ne sont pas un travail de groupe pour vos différends. Il existe trois formes d’élimination des erreurs.

    • Réécrivez l’impression SELECT afin que l’expression, également déterminée en tant que colonne SELECT en mémoire, apparaisse peut-être même dans l’offre GROUP BY.
    • Vous pouvez supprimer complètement notre propre nouvelle fonction GROUP BY de toutes les instructions SELECT.
    • Supprimez tous les mots qui n’appartiennent pas à la clause GROUP BY réelle de la liste SELECT.

    Le correctif exact pour obtenir l’erreur doit être appliqué à l’exemple suivant ici, où cet utilisateur essaie d’exécuter une instruction SELECT :

    SELECT faculté, cadre éducatif, MAX (nombre) AS "La plupart des étudiants"

    Par étudiant

    GROUP BY département;

    Dans cet exemple, l’erreur peut être facilement corrigée en incluant la session de tutoriel dans la stipulation GROUP BY. La classe est contenue dans le type des instructions SELECT et GROUP BY.

    SELECT Faculté, Élégance, MAX. (nombre) AS "La plupart des étudiants"

    Par étudiant

    GROUP BY département, classe ;

    Attendez

    Pour éviter de voir ORA-00979, assurez-vous que le mouvement est intégré dans la liste SELECT et en plus dans la clause GROUP BY. Si l’expression inclut également la clause GROUP BY non abrégée, vous devriez probablement vraiment voir l’erreur. Si toute votre famille continue de voir toutes les erreurs et que le problème est résolu, contactez directement votre administrateur de base de données. Vous allez également contacter un consultant commercial certifié Oracle. Assurez-vous toujours qu’ils possèdent l’expertise nécessaire pour répondre à vos besoins Oracle avant d’utiliser leurs remèdes.

    Est

    Ora-00979

    Réécrivez une instruction SELECT de sorte que l’expression ou la colonne particulière dans la liste SELECT soit également une clause GROUP BY.Vous pouvez supprimer complètement la fonctionnalité GROUP BY de l’instruction SELECT.Utilisez la clause GROUP BY pour priver toutes les expressions individuelles qui leur appartiennent définitivement de la même liste SELECT.

    ora-00979 associé à la clause GROUP BY. Lorsque le visage de l’utilisateur regarde cette erreur, le message suivant est considéré comme affiché :

    sql error ora-00979 not a group near expression

    Comme d’autres bogues, Oracle ORA-00979 a également toujours été simple et peut être facilement corrigé par l’une des trois méthodes.

    Problème

    ORA-00979 se produit lorsque la clause GROUP BY ne contient pas toutes les expressions exactes des termes SELECT. Chaque instruction SELECT qui n’est pas trop contenue dans une fonction GROUP doit très souvent être spécifiée dans une clause GROUP BY. Ce sont AVG, COUNT, MAX, SUM, min, STDDEV ainsi que , VARIANCE. Vous essaierez probablement également d’exécuter une instruction SELECT composée d’une clause GROUP BY.

    Solution

    Pour corriger ce modèle d’erreur, incluez toutes les factures SELECT dans la clause GROUP BY. Assurez-vous d’exprimer des valeurs ne sont pas de bonnes raisons pour la fonction de groupe. Il y aura trois méthodes pour résoudre les erreurs.

    • Réécrivez l’instruction SELECT afin que son expression ou sa colonne, répertoriée dans la liste SELECT générale, soit très souvent également incluse dans la clause GROUP.
    • Vous pouvez effacer complètement la fonction GROUP BY de notre instruction SELECT sur la place de marché.
    • Supprimez de cette liste SELECT presque tous les mots et expressions qui n’appartiennent certainement pas à la clause GROUP BY correspondante.

    La première option pour corriger cette erreur s’applique à un nouvel exemple précédent, dans lequel l’utilisateur a tort d’exécuter le SELECT :

    Dans cet exemple, l’erreur sera corrigée en incluant le collège dans la clause GROUP BY. La classe est incluse dans les instructions SELECT et GROUP BY. Suivant

    À

    Évitez de regarder ORA-00979, assurez-vous que les expressions de la liste SELECT sont également incluses dans chaque clause GROUP BY différente. Si le gestionnaire est également un opérateur pour la clause généralement GROUP BY, vous devriez plutôt voir cette erreur. Si vous rencontrez toujours l’erreur et que le danger est difficile à résoudre, contactez l’administrateur de la base de données d’une personne. Vous pouvez également prendre contact avec ce consultant certifié Oracle. Avant d’utiliserLorsque vous utilisez le service, assurez-vous toujours qu’il dispose des informations d’identification correctes ainsi que de l’expertise pour vos besoins Oracle.

    sql error ora-00979 certainement un groupe par expression

     

     

    Téléchargez ce logiciel et réparez votre PC en quelques minutes.

    Pour corriger ORA-00979 : pas un groupe par expression, assurez-vous simplement que toutes les colonnes GROUP BY correspondent généralement à la clause SELECT. Vous pouvez faire l’élément en mettant les colonnes dans GROUP BY. Les colonnes n’ont pas besoin d’être dans le même ordre pour vous aider à corriger les erreurs courantes.

    Cette erreur SQL signifie que cette base de données est considérée comme essayant généralement de se regrouper pour des raisons qu’elle ne peut pas faire. Cela signifie généralement qu’il y a des agrégats dans ces définitions de la notation.

     

     

     

    Sql Error Ora 00979 Not A Group By Expression
    Error De Sql Ora 00979 No Es Un Grupo Por Expresion
    Errore Sql Ora 00979 Non E Un Gruppo Per Espressione
    Sql 오류 Ora 00979 표현식에 의한 그룹이 아닙니다
    Sql Fehler Ora 00979 Keine Gruppe Nach Ausdruck
    Sql Fel Ora 00979 Inte En Grupp Efter Uttryck
    Erro Sql Ora 00979 Nao E Um Grupo Por Expressao
    Blad Sql Ora 00979 Nie Jest Grupowany Wedlug Wyrazenia
    Sql Fout Ora 00979 Geen Groep Op Uitdrukking
    Oshibka Sql Ora 00979 Ne Gruppa Po Vyrazheniyu